Security Specialist
Job Purpose: Under general supervision, provide security management support to the Office of Naval Research (ONR) Corporate Logistics Department at ONR Headquarters in an office environment with a variety of moderate to complex tasks and functional activity.
Job Duties Include: The following are essential functions for the Security Specialist position. Management may assign additional duties and responsibilities to this job at any time due to reasonable accommodation or other reasons.
- Enter sensitive data into computer databases such as the Joint Personnel Adjudication System (JPAS) and spreadsheets.
- Process requests for Courier Authorization (DD Form 2501).
- Verify identification and leverage the Defense Enrollment Eligibility Reporting System (DEERS)/Real-time Automated Personnel Identification System (RAPIDS) to issue Common Access Cards, update database information, and reset personal identification numbers.
- Process all domestic and foreign visit requests to ONR.
- Maintain and update the Security website daily/weekly/monthly.
- Serve as the point of contact for Security website material, including security training and building access requests.
- Greet visitors either in person or via the telephone.
- Assist visitors with information, as needed.
- Direct visitors to the appropriate security specialist, as needed.
- Operate office equipment (e.g., computers, typewriters, faxes, printers, scanners, copiers).
- Draft, edit, and type various documents in electronic and paper media.
- Maintain various databases.
- Serves as Content Coordinator for Security Division iConnect site.
- Maintain open lines of communication with all ONR Administrative Officers (AO).
- Assist other members of the ONR Security Division during routine/emergency situations.
- Maintain open lines of communication with Contract Security Officers and Pentagon Force Protection Agency.
- Assist in the entrance of VIPs to ONR Headquarters building.
- Assist with classified and unclassified meetings where groups are larger than 25 people.
- In the absence of the Classified Document Control Clerk, receive and secure all SECRET and CONFIDENTIAL material.
- Provide backup support ONR duplicating machine operator and driver/courier as needed.
Skills/Qualifications: Excellent skills in the following areas: management, planning, communication, problem solving. Following applies:
- Possess a working knowledge of Microsoft Word and Excel.
- Possess a working knowledge of Joint Personnel Adjudications System (JPAS) or other automated database systems.
- Possess a working knowledge of Defense Enrollment Eligibility Reporting System (DEERS).
- Possess a working knowledge of Real-time Automated Personnel Identification System (RAPIDS).
- The ability to work independently.
- Possess effective collaboration, oral / writing skills to support interaction with required organizational levels in ONR.
Military Installation Access: This position resides on a military installation. Candidate must be able to qualify for and maintain a base access pass.
Clearance: Must currently possess or be able to secure a SECRET clearance.
Education and Experience: Must possess either a (1) Associate’s Degree from an accredited institution and 1-2 years of relevant experience as a Security Specialist or (2) a High School Diploma or GED Equivalent and 3-5 years of relevant experience as a Security Specialist. Experience with government and DoD environments is desired.
